What Are Local SEO Citations?

A local SEO citation is an online mention of a business’s important information. A citation commonly includes the business name, address, and phone number, often referred to as NAP.

Citations can appear on business directories, local websites, industry-specific websites, social platforms, and other online resources.

For example, a local restaurant may have its business information listed on a local directory. A plumbing company may have a listing on a home-services directory.

Why Are Local Citations Important?

1. They Help Customers Find Your Business

Accurate business listings make it easier for potential customers to discover a local business online. Customers can use the information to visit the business website, call the company, or find its physical location.

2. They Support Local Search Visibility

Consistent business information across reputable websites can help search engines understand that a business is legitimate and associated with a particular location.

This can support a business’s overall local search presence.

3. They Build Trust

When customers see the same business information across multiple reliable sources, it can create a stronger sense of trust.

On the other hand, incorrect or conflicting information may cause confusion and make customers uncertain about which information is correct.

What Information Should a Local Citation Include?

A local citation may include several important details, such as:

  • Business name
  • Address
  • Phone number
  • Website URL
  • Business category
  • Business description
  • Opening hours

The exact information required can vary depending on the website or directory.

How to Build Local SEO Citations

Step 1: Prepare Accurate Business Information

Before creating listings, prepare your correct business name, address, phone number, website, business category, and opening hours.

Step 2: Find Relevant Directories

Look for trustworthy business directories and websites that are relevant to your industry or local area.

A business should focus on quality and relevance instead of creating listings on every available website.

Step 3: Keep Information Consistent

Use the same core business information across your listings. Check your existing profiles regularly and correct outdated information when necessary.

Step 4: Monitor Your Listings

Businesses can periodically review their online listings to identify incorrect information, duplicate listings, or outdated details.

Common Local Citation Mistakes

Some common mistakes include:

  • Using different business names on different websites
  • Providing an incorrect phone number
  • Using an old business address
  • Creating duplicate listings
  • Choosing an unrelated business category
  • Ignoring outdated business information

Avoiding these mistakes can help maintain a cleaner and more trustworthy local online presence.
